Как отправить сообщение через Telegram API? - коротко
Для отправки сообщения через Telegram API требуется использовать метод sendMessage
. Этот метод позволяет передавать текст и дополнительные параметры, такие как идентификатор чата, в котором будет отправлено сообщение.
Как отправить сообщение через Telegram API? - развернуто
Отправка сообщений через Telegram API является мощным инструментом для автоматизации и взаимодействия с пользователями. Для начала работы с API необходимо выполнить несколько шагов, которые включают регистрацию бота, получение токена доступа и использование соответствующих методов для отправки сообщений.
Во-первых, вам нужно зарегистрировать бота через Telegram. Для этого введите в поисковую строку Telegram @BotFather и следуйте инструкциям для создания нового бота. После успешного создания бота вы получите токен доступа, который необходимо будет использовать для авторизации в API.
Следующий шаг заключается в настройке окружения для работы с Telegram API. Наиболее распространенные языки программирования для взаимодействия с API включают Python, JavaScript и PHP. В данном примере мы рассмотрим использование Python с библиотекой python-telegram-bot
.
Для начала установите необходимую библиотеку с помощью pip:
pip install python-telegram-bot
После установки библиотеки создайте файл с кодом, который будет отправлять сообщения. Пример такого кода может выглядеть следующим образом:
import telegram
# Замените 'YOUR_TOKEN' на ваш токен доступа
bot = telegram.Bot(token='YOUR_TOKEN')
# Укажите идентификатор пользователя или чата, куда будет отправлено сообщение
chat_id = 'CHAT_ID'
# Создайте сообщение
message = "Привет! Это тестовое сообщение от вашего бота."
# Отправьте сообщение
bot.send_message(chat_id=chat_id, text=message)
В этом примере YOUR_TOKEN
должен быть заменен на токен доступа, полученный от @BotFather, а CHAT_ID
- на идентификатор чата или пользователя, куда будет отправлено сообщение.
Для более сложных сценариев можно использовать различные методы API, такие как отправка изображений, файлов, создание кнопок и многое другое. Telegram API предоставляет широкий спектр возможностей для интеграции и автоматизации, что делает его мощным инструментом для разработчиков.
Важно помнить, что при работе с API необходимо соблюдать все правила и условия использования Telegram, чтобы избежать блокировки бота или других нарушений.
Таким образом, отправка сообщений через Telegram API включает в себя несколько шагов: регистрация бота, получение токена доступа и использование соответствующих методов для отправки сообщений. Этот процесс позволяет эффективно взаимодействовать с пользователями и автоматизировать различные задачи.